Japan Mountain Kitchen

Japanese Asian

0 stars out of 5.

Shop 5, 135 / 141 Macquarie Road, Springwood, 2777

Pick-up only

Includes the main dish, a small Takoyaki or Edameme for vegetarians, and a small salad.

Your order